NIGERIA—Nigeria’s Imo State Government has launched a transformative initiative in healthcare by signing a multi-partner agreement to build a cutting-edge medical facility equipped with artificial intelligence and robotic surgery.
Governor Hope Uzodimma recently greenlit the deal, paving the way for the nation’s first such collaboration.
This move introduces advanced tools like the da Vinci robotic surgical system, promising to elevate medical care across the region.
Governor Uzodimma celebrated the agreement as a pivotal achievement in the state’s medical program.
He emphasized the commitment to creating a world-class facility that leverages AI, robotic surgery, and top-tier care for residents.
The partnership unites the Imo State Government with Heartland Hospital Management Corporation, The Prostate Clinic, and Imo Digital City Limited.
Together, they blend hospital management reforms with innovative surgical technologies.
At the heart of this project stands Professor Kingsley Ekwueme, a world-class robotic surgeon and the trailblazer of robotic surgery in West Africa, who originates from Imo State.
Governor Uzodimma highlighted the fortune of having such expertise at home.
“Charity begins at home,” he noted, adding that Ekwueme has pledged to return his skills, backed fully by the government.
The state has already approved all required documents, targeting full operations by year’s end and with this approval, implementation kicks off right away.
This development promises to curb medical tourism abroad and turn Imo State into a hub for advanced healthcare.
Governor Uzodimma explained that it will draw patients from beyond the state’s borders while delivering high-quality services locally.
Professor Ekwueme described the partnership as unprecedented in Nigeria.
He called it a historic milestone, especially for Imo State, and accepted the governor’s invitation after observing profound changes in the local health sector.
Ekwueme pointed to the Imo State Health Insurance Scheme as a key driver of this progress.
The program has enrolled over 1.4 million people, bringing healthcare directly to communities in an extraordinary way.
For him, introducing robotic surgery to his home state feels both professional and deeply personal.
He first pioneered the technology in Lagos, West Africa’s initial site, and now delights in expanding it to Imo, where its benefits will resonate widely.
Under the agreement, Heartland Hospital Management Corporation oversees daily operations.
Meanwhile, The Prostate Clinic and Imo Digital City Limited supply the essential technical setup and specialized equipment.
Officials at the Imo State Government House, where the signing occurred, confirmed that teams will now install robotic systems and train staff immediately.
